Columbia Pipe & Supply’s corporate offices had not been updated since the early 1980’s and were inundated with fragmented and inefficient operations resulting from patchwork expansion over the years.
Upon analysis of Columbia’s business structure, workflow needs, and space requirements to meet its current operations, our evaluation process helped identify a plan to allow Columbia to operate more efficiently, and for some departments, in less space. Overall design goals were also established to define the work environment that Columbia had envisioned.
In response to Columbia’s desire to reinforce their identity, the interior design draws upon patterns and materials that reflect their business and culture and clearly communicates that this is a company entrenched in the building infrastructure industry.
